Question

Give reason:

Transpiration is an important process in plants.

Solution

Explanation:

Transpiration-

  1. Plants continuously absorb water from the soil through their roots.
  2. The absorbed water is distributed to all parts of the plants through xylem.
  3. Some amount of water is utilised for photosynthesis process and rest is evaporated through leaves when the stomata is open.
  4. Transpiration is the loss of water in the form of water vapor from the aerial parts of the plants.

Reason-

  1. Transpiration is an important process in plants because when water gets evaporated it gives cooling effect to the plants during hot day.
  2. Also, transpiration helps in maintaining the concentration of sap inside the plant body.
